Error: "Error al analizar XML: XML o declaración de texto no al inicio de la entidad"

Estoy haciendo una aplicación Android de Sudoku y estoy recibiendo los siguientes errores en main.xml: "error: Error al analizar XML: XML o declaración de texto no al inicio de la entidad" Cualquier ayuda sería apreciada. Aquí está mi código. Puse '✗' junto al error

`✗<?xml version="1.0" encoding="utf-8"?> <LinearLayout xmlns:android="http://schemas.android.com/apk/res/android" android:orientation="vertical" android:layout_height="fill_parent" android:layout_width="fill_parent"> <TextView android:layout_width="fill_parent" android:layout_height="wrap_content" android:text="@String/continue_label"/> <Button android:id="@+id/continue_button" android:layout_width="fill_parent" android:layout_height="wrap_content" android:text="@string/continue_label" /> <Button android:id="@+id/new_button" android:layout_width="fill_parent" android:layout_height="wrap_content" android:text="@string/new_game_label"/> <Button android:id="@+id/about_button" android:layout_Width="fill_parent" android:layout_height="wrap_content" android:text="@string/new_game_label"/> <Button android:id="@+id/exit_button" android:layout_Width="fill_parent" android:layout_height="wrap_content" android:text="@string/exit_label"/> </LinearLayout> 

Puede haber dos casos –

Caso 1 – Si tiene un espacio vacío antes de la primera instrucción.

Caso 2 – Si has puesto accidentalmente la misma instrucción de los espacios de nombres dos veces, es decir -? Xml version = "1.0" encoding = "utf-8"?

Lo hice una vez y aterrizó con el mismo error de la suya después de corregir mi código funciona muy bien. Espero que esto ayude

La mayoría de las veces, el error "Error Parsing XML" se debe a "espacio vacío". Esto hizo que JVM NO inflar adecuadamente los elementos de vista en Actividad. Por lo tanto, recomiendo que …. para evitar que, en lugar de buscar manualmente los espacios, haga lo siguiente: –

Paso 1. Ctrl + A -> seleccionar todo el código en XML.

Paso 2. Ctrl + I -> Indentación automática del código en XML

(** Los accesos directos son para Eclipse IDE)

El único problema que puedo ver con tu xml es que dos veces has escrito

 android:layout_Width 

en lugar de

 android:layout_width 

Aparte de que su xml se ve bien. Como Matthew Wilson sugirió, asegúrese de que no hay nada delante de la declaración xml

Si esto no funciona, intente crear un nuevo archivo xml (en Eclipse a través del menú Archivo> Nuevo -> Archivo XML de Android). A continuación, agregue las partes de su parte xml existente para la parte y cada vez que verifique si sigue siendo válida. De esta manera puede identificar la ubicación de sus problemas.

Hay un espaciado y esta "✗" infront de <?xml version="1.0" encoding="utf-8"?>

Sacar eso y funcionaría.

  • Eclipse: reemplaza la ruta de biblioteca definida en project.properties
  • Depuración de Android con Eclipse - sin puntos de interrupción
  • ¿Por qué no se actualizan mis archivos de activos?
  • Cuando depuro mi aplicación consigo con frecuencia el error del lanzamiento: No pudo conectar con la VM alejada
  • Exportar la interfaz de usuario de Inventor de aplicaciones a Eclipse
  • Referencia de valores de una matriz en java
  • Java no funciona con regex \ s, dice: inválido secuencia de escape
  • "No se encontró la descripción del mensaje" en strings.xml
  • "No se puede ejecutar dex: límite de sobrecarga de GC superado"
  • Error al crear el mensaje de error de la clase BuildConfig en eclipse
  • No se puede importar o crear un nuevo proyecto desde muestras o descargas en Android / Eclipse
  • FlipAndroid es un fan de Google para Android, Todo sobre Android Phones, Android Wear, Android Dev y Aplicaciones para Android Aplicaciones.